Roland barthes is a good coffee talker. Any episode of language which stages the absence of the loved object- whatever its cause and its duration- and which tends to transform this absence into an ordeal of abandonment. Now, absense can exist only as a consequence of the other: it is the other who leaves, it is I who remain. The other is in a condition of perpetual departure, of journeying; the other is, by vocation, migrant, fugitive. Is constituted only by the confrontation with an always absent. If it...
